How long is the flight from BDS to DUB?
Great-circle distance is 2,301 km. With typical jet cruise speed plus taxi, climb and descent, expect roughly 192–227 min gate-to-gate on this route.
How often does BDS–DUB fly?
Ryanair runs the route with about 3 flights a week (mon, thu, sat). Since one carrier owns the route, a single disruption tends to ripple through the day.
What does the route health score measure?
A blend of departure-side delay at BDS and arrival-side delay at DUB, computed from rolling delay windows (refreshed every 40 minutes) with a daily-rollup fallback. Current MVFR, IFR, or LIFR endpoint weather caps the score when flight rules can limit throughput. Higher is healthier: 100 means operations are clean at both ends.
